I love this cooker! Seems like you can not go wrong.

We looked at the weather and this past Thursday was the perfect day to be outside cooking. I had the recipe prepared. I got it from this forum, but I can't remember who posted it. May have been Tommy. But anyway thanks to whoever shared it!

I cooked the ribs naked for about 40 minutes after removing the membrane and putting the hangers in.





I removed them when they were just starting to get that crispy bark.



I put some dry rub on them, wrapped them in foil, and laid them in the basket for an additional 40 minutes. (I got the dry rub recipe from the free Big Easy Cooking guide from lifesatomato.com)

Pulled them out and put some Sweet Baby Ray's on them. Rewrapped them and put them on for about 10 more minutes.



The wife had made cole slaw and we ate well! These will be a regular in our house!
